Diaz and Barrymore are Old Acquaintences

After the eyecandy parade that was the Charlie’s Angels movies, I am surprised it took this long for Drew Barrymore and Cameron Diaz to work on something together again. And this time they are serious. They plan to remake a 40s classic Old Acquaintance.

MovieHole.com says

According to Sky News, Barrymore and Diaz will play an evil twosome – Miriam Hpkins and Bette Davis played the roles in the original – in the tale of a novelist who engages in a heated rivalry with a long time friend in both her professional and personal lives.

“We had a ball together on Charlie’s Angels and have been looking for a script ever since. We think this looks great”, Cameron tells the site.

The kneejerk reaction to this news is that we will see this movie as a zany comedy. But I for one see this as a great opportunity to show the range these girls are capable of.

Barrymore is known for her romantic comedies but is actually quite good in dramas as well. Its been a long time since we have seen her in anything deep. Same with Diaz. Aside from the dozens of Shrek projects, and Charlie’s Angels, we have seen many examples of serious roles for her. It should be very cool to see these two playing off each other in a serious role.
